The Role of Registered Agents
Official agents serve a important function for businesses by acting as their primary point of contact with the state. In Washington, a designated agent is required for all business structures, including S corps and LLCs. This agent is responsible for receiving important legal documents, such as lawsuits, subpoenas, and official state correspondence. By ensuring that these documents are properly delivered and managed, official agents help companies maintain alignment with state regulations.
In addition to receiving legal notifications, registered agents in Washington provide organizations with key privacy protection. By designating a business agent, companies can keep their private addresses off government files, thus shielding sensitive information from public disclosure. This is particularly vital for entrepreneurs who operate from home and wish to maintain a level of privacy while still adhering to compliance standards.

Legal Obligations for Registered Representatives in Washington
In Washington, every corporate entity formed under local law is obligated to appoint a registered agent. This agent acts as the primary contact person for handling legal documents, government mail, and important notices. The designated agent must maintain a real location in WA, known as the registered location, which ensures that they are available during regular business hours. This obligation guarantees that there is a reliable means of contact between the government and the entity.
Additionally, the registered agent can be an person or a business entity that is licensed to carry out business in Washington. If an agent is chosen, they must be a dweller of the state and at least eighteen years of age old. Businesses may choose to appoint their own staff as registered agents, or they can engage a professional registered agent service to fulfill this role. This option allows companies to select agents that most comprehend their specific requirements and functions.
Neglect to maintain a designated agent can result to various penalties, including the loss to legally conduct business in WA. It is vital for entities to keep their registered agent information up to date with the Secretary of State of Washington, especially if there are changes in ownership or location. This adherence not only meets legal requirements but also helps maintain good standing with state authorities, protecting the company's functionality and reputation.
